Lupin loses patent suit about Ramipril in AmericaMUMBAI: Pharmaceutical company Lupin on Thursday said a district court in the US has ruled against the company in a patent infringement suit filed by Sanofi-Aventis and King Pharmaceuticals. “It was a very close call for us and we are disappointed that the Court found the patent to be valid, albeit reluctantly, in the judge’s own words,” said Lupin MD Kamal Sharma. The company plans to appeal this decision to the federal circuit court, Mr Sharma added. The court’s decision followed a suit filed by King Pharmaceuticals and Sanofi-Aventis against Lupin alleging infringement on the ‘5061722’ patent. The trial was completed in June ’06.
